# y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update

Updates the specified captcha.

#### Command Usage

Syntax:

`y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update <CAPTCHA-ID>`

#### Flags

#|
||Flag | Description ||
|| `--update-mask` | `[]string`

Field paths for FieldMask: each segment may be proto snake_case or CLI kebab-case (e.g. name, labels, network-interface). Repeat the flag or use comma-separated values. When set and non-empty, takes precedence over update_mask in the request body/file and over mask inferred from -r. If omitted or empty, the mask is built from the fields you pass (changed flags, JSON/shorthand, and request file when update_mask is absent there). ||
|| `--id` | `string`

ID of the captcha to update. ||
|| `--name` | `string`

Name of the captcha. The name must be unique within the folder. ||
|| `--allowed-sites` | `[]string`

List of allowed host names, see documentation. ||
|| `--complexity` | `enum`

Complexity of the captcha. Possible Values: 'easy', 'medium', 'hard', 'force-hard' ||
|| `--style-json` | `string`

JSON with variables to define the captcha appearance. For more details see generated JSON in cloud console. ||
|| `--turn-off-hostname-check` | Turn off host name check, see documentation. ||
|| `--pre-check-type` | `enum`

Basic check type of the captcha. Possible Values: 'checkbox', 'slider' ||
|| `--challenge-type` | `enum`

Additional task type of the captcha. Possible Values: 'image-text', 'silhouettes', 'kaleidoscope' ||
|| `--security-rules` | `shorthand/json`

List of security rules.

|| `--deletion-protection` | Determines whether captcha is protected from being deleted. ||
|| `--override-variants` | `shorthand/json`

List of variants to use in security_rules

|| `--disallow-data-processing` | If true, Yandex team won't be able to read internal data. ||
|| `--description` | `string`

Optional description of the captcha. ||
|| `--labels` | `map<string><string>`

Resource labels as 'key:value' pairs. ||
|| `--async` | Display information about the operation in progress, without waiting for the operation to complete. ||
|| `-r`, `--request-file` | `string`

Path to a request file. ||
|| `--example-json` | Generates a JSON template of the request. ||
|| `-e`, `--example-yaml` | Generates a YAML template of the request.

The template can be customized and used as input for the command.

Usage example:

1. Generate template:
y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update --example-json > request.json
or
y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update --example-yaml > request.yaml

2. Edit the template file

3. Run with template:
y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update -r request.json
or
yc smartcaptcha v1 captcha update -r request.yaml ||
|#
